Lexicon :: Strong's G4714 - stasis

Choose a new font size and typeface
στάσις
Transliteration
stasis (Key)
Pronunciation
stas'-is
Listen
Part of Speech
feminine noun
Root Word (Etymology)
From the base of ἵστημι (G2476)
Dictionary Aids

Vine's Expository Dictionary: View Entry

TDNT Reference: 7:568,1070

Strong’s Definitions

στάσις stásis, stas'-is; from the base of G2476; a standing (properly, the act), i.e. (by analogy) position (existence); by implication, a popular uprising; figuratively, controversy:—dissension, insurrection, × standing, uproar.

STRONGS G4714:
στάσις, στάσεως, (ἵστημι);
1. a standing, station, state: ἔχειν στάσιν, to stand, exist, have stability, Latin locum habere [R. V. is yet standing], Hebrews 9:8 (Polybius 5, 5, 3).
2. from Aeschylus and Herodotus down, an insurrection (cf. German Aufstand): Mark 15:7; Luke 23:19, 25; Acts 19:40 (see σήμερον, under the end); κινεῖν στάσιν (L T Tr WH στάσεις) τίνι (a mover of insurrections among i. e.) against (cf. Winer's Grammar, 208 (196)) one, Acts 24:5.
3. strife, dissension (Aeschylus Pers. 738; (Diogenes Laërtius 3, 51): Acts 15:2; Acts 23:7, 10.
